Today is also Lughnassadh, the celebration of the first harvest. Some traditions also celebrate the festival at 15 degrees Leo, rather than by a fixed date on a solar calendar. Traditionally, this is the day that Lugh held funeral games in honour of his mother, Taillté, which is why they are called the Tailltéan Games. It is also a day where marriages were arranged, and handfastings for a year and a day were performed - a sort of trial marriage to determine if the pairing was fertile and compatible. Sometimes this festival is also called Lammas, derived from "Loaf mass" - since I'm not christian, I use the gaelic word for the holiday. Corn dollies, grains, red flowers, and summer berries, fruits, and vegetables are some of the common symbols of this feast day. Symbolic also are the colours of the harvest: green, gold, and yellow.
